BULL & FINCH (Serial No. 73670122), Registration No. 1508083, is a registered US trademark filed on Jul 06, 1987 by HAMPSHIRE HOUSE CORP.. This trademark covers Class 016 (Paper goods, books & stationery), Class 018 (Leather goods, bags & accessories), Class 021 (Household utensils, cookware & glassware), Class 025 (Clothing, footwear & headgear), Class 034 (Tobacco, smokers' articles & e-cigarettes).
